Tuncer Özekinci is a scholar working on Epidemiology, Infectious Diseases and Hepatology. According to data from OpenAlex, Tuncer Özekinci has authored 23 papers receiving a total of 523 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Epidemiology, 9 papers in Infectious Diseases and 8 papers in Hepatology. Recurrent topics in Tuncer Özekinci's work include Hepatitis B Virus Studies (7 papers), Hepatitis Viruses Studies and Epidemiology (5 papers) and Hepatitis C virus research (5 papers). Tuncer Özekinci is often cited by papers focused on Hepatitis B Virus Studies (7 papers), Hepatitis Viruses Studies and Epidemiology (5 papers) and Hepatitis C virus research (5 papers). Tuncer Özekinci collaborates with scholars based in Türkiye and Cyprus. Tuncer Özekinci's co-authors include Ertuğrul Ercan, Yusuf Çelik, Günay Saka, Şerif Yılmaz, Ali Ceylan, Melikşah Ertem, Selahattin Atmaca, Abdurrahman Abakay, Salih Hoşoğlu and Fuat Gürkan and has published in prestigious journals such as Journal of Endodontics, Journal of Oral and Maxillofacial Surgery and Epidemiology and Infection.
